How much does a Greenbrier Hospital Accounts Payable make?

As of March 2025, the average annual salary for an Accounts Payable at Greenbrier Hospital is $42,508, which translates to approximately $20 per hour. Salaries for Accounts Payable at Greenbrier Hospital typically range from $38,843 to $46,277, reflecting the diverse roles within the company.

Greenbrier Hospital is a licensed 60-bed psychiatric treatment facility that specializes in providing life-affirming care to adult patients who have a primary diagnosis involving a mental health disorder. Greenbrier Hospital was recently fully renovated, and services are available via our inpatient, partial hospitalization, and intensive outpatient programs, in order to assure that each individual can receive care at the level that is best suited to his or her strengths and needs. Elements that may be incorporated into an individual's personalized treatment plan include detoxification, medication management, individual therapy, group therapy, family therapy, and activity therapy. Among the professionals with whom a patient may work while in treatment at Greenbrier Hospital are psychiatrists, medical psychologists, nurse practitioners, nurses, licensed clinical social workers, licensed counselors, activity therapists, mental health technicians, and a staff dietician. As a complement to the thorough assessment that all patients complete when they enter treatment, Greenbrier Hospital also provides comprehensive discharge planning services to ensure each individual is prepared to maintain and build upon the progress that he or she made while in our care.
